Top 5 Puzzle RPG Apps on Android in Costa Rica: Q3 2022 Performance
An overview of the performance of the top 5 Puzzle RPG apps on Android in Costa Rica during Q3 2022, including weekly downloads, revenue, and active users trends.
The third quarter of 2022 saw notable trends in the Puzzle RPG category on the Android platform in Costa Rica. Here's an in-depth look at the performance of the top 5 applications in this category, based on data from Sensor Tower.
Empires & Puzzles: Match-3 RPG
Empires & Puzzles: Match-3 RPG experienced a varied performance in Q3 2022. Weekly revenue started at approximately $1.4K at the end of June and saw a dip to around $792 by mid-July. However, it recovered slightly to hover around $1K towards the end of September. Weekly downloads fluctuated, with a peak of 463 in mid-July, and then a gradual decline to 231 by the end of September. Active users showed a slight downward trend from 2.5K at the start of the quarter to 2.3K by the end.
DRAGON BALL Z DOKKAN BATTLE
DRAGON BALL Z DOKKAN BATTLE had a dynamic quarter. Weekly revenue saw significant spikes, reaching up to $872 at the end of August, and then fluctuating between $185 and $587 in September. Weekly downloads started strong at 2K at the beginning of July but declined to 745 by the end of September. Active users remained relatively stable, with a slight decrease from 3.7K at the beginning of the quarter to around 3K by the end.
Best Fiends - Match 3 Puzzles
Best Fiends - Match 3 Puzzles showed moderate performance in terms of weekly revenue, staying fairly consistent around $100-$150 throughout the quarter. Downloads were low, peaking at 95 at the start of July and declining to 25 by the end of September. Active users had a slight variation, starting at 2.5K at the end of June and maintaining around 2.2K by late September.
Call of Antia: Match 3 RPG
Call of Antia: Match 3 RPG saw a significant increase in weekly revenue, reaching up to $363 by mid-September from a modest $43 at the end of June. Downloads, however, remained low, peaking at 118 in early July and dropping to just 31 by the end of September. Active users showed a gradual decrease from about 380 at the start of July to 251 by the end of September.
WWE Champions
WWE Champions had a mixed quarter. Weekly revenue ranged from $63 to $150, with notable peaks in early September and late September. Downloads were consistently low, peaking at 74 in mid-September. Active users increased steadily from 98 at the end of June to 169 by the end of September.
